Innovative Motor Mounts ?

I'm looking into getting the Innovative Mounts for my Acura 3.2cl-s, I 've read mixed reviews, I know that the OEM ones are garbage and last only 2 years, what should I do , I don't want to change them anymore and Innovative offers a lifetime warranty, anybody have any ideas or have tried them , like them or recommend them let me know I have to change my Motor mount very fast...

AVOID THEM! Worse mod I have ever done on the car. They were great for about 2 months then all went to hell as they deteriorated and the car was shaking like Michael J Fox from all the vibrations.
